📖 What is Semester CGPA (SGPA)?

Semester CGPA (commonly called SGPA — Semester Grade Point Average) is the academic performance measurement for a single semester or term. It represents the credit-weighted average of grade points earned across all courses taken in that specific semester. Unlike cumulative CGPA which aggregates across all completed semesters, SGPA captures performance in just one term — providing semester-by-semester snapshots of your academic journey.

🎯 The Core Concept

Think of SGPA as a "report card score" for one semester. After every semester, your university calculates:

  • Your grade points in each course (based on letter grade or marks)
  • The credit hours for each course (varies by subject type and university)
  • The weighted average across all courses you took that semester

This produces a single number — your SGPA — that reflects how well you performed in that specific term.

📐 The Formula

SGPA = Σ(Grade Points × Credit Hours) ÷ Σ(Credit Hours) Where: - Grade Points = Numerical value of letter grade (e.g., O=10, A+=9, A=8, B+=7, B=6 in India) - Credit Hours = Course weight (typically 1-5) - Σ = "sum of" - Σ(GP × Cr) = total "quality points" for semester - Σ(Cr) = total credit hours that semester Result: Single SGPA number on your scale (0-10 in India, 0-4 in US)

🔄 The Mathematical Relationship

CGPA is the credit-weighted average of all your SGPAs:

CGPA = Σ(SGPA × Semester Credits) ÷ Σ(All Credits) Example: After 4 semesters Sem 1: SGPA 7.8, 22 credits Sem 2: SGPA 8.2, 24 credits Sem 3: SGPA 8.5, 22 credits Sem 4: SGPA 8.7, 23 credits Quality Points = (7.8×22) + (8.2×24) + (8.5×22) + (8.7×23) = 171.6 + 196.8 + 187.0 + 200.1 = 755.5 Total Credits = 22 + 24 + 22 + 23 = 91 CGPA = 755.5 ÷ 91 = 8.30 Note: Simple average of SGPAs would be (7.8+8.2+8.5+8.7)/4 = 8.30 This matches because credits are similar across semesters. When credits vary widely, CGPA differs from simple SGPA average.

🧮 How to Calculate Semester CGPA

The semester CGPA (SGPA) calculation is straightforward when you understand the credit-weighted average concept. Follow these steps for accurate calculation:

📋 Step-by-Step Process

Step 1: Identify Your Grade Scale

First, determine your university's grading scale. Most common: India 10-point CBCS (O=10, A+=9, A=8, B+=7, B=6, C=5, P=4, F=0). US 4.0 scale: A=4.0, A−=3.7, B+=3.3, B=3.0, etc. Verify with your university handbook or transcript legend.

Step 2: List All Courses This Semester

Make a list of every course you took this semester, including:

  • Course name
  • Letter grade or numerical grade received
  • Credit hours assigned to that course
  • Course type (theory, lab, project) if relevant

Step 3: Convert Letter Grades to Grade Points

Look up each letter grade's numerical value on your grading scale. Engineering students typically use: O=10, A+=9, A=8, B+=7, B=6, C=5, P=4, F=0.

Step 4: Calculate Quality Points per Course

For each course: Quality Points = Grade Points × Credit Hours. This is the credit-weighted contribution of that course to your semester performance.

Step 5: Sum Total Quality Points and Total Credits

Add up all quality points across all courses, and separately add up all credit hours.

Step 6: Divide for SGPA

SGPA = Total Quality Points ÷ Total Credits. The result is your semester GPA.

Step 7: Verify Against Official Records

Compare your calculated SGPA with the official one on your grade sheet. If they differ:

  • Re-verify your grade-to-point conversions
  • Check if any courses have special weighting (capstone projects, thesis)
  • Confirm credit hours match official records
  • If still discrepant, contact your registrar — calculation errors can happen

📊 Step-by-Step Worked Examples

📚 Example 1: Engineering Student (Standard Semester)

Arjun's 3rd semester courses at an Indian engineering college:

CourseGradeGrade PointsCreditsQuality Points
Engineering Mathematics IIIA+9436
Digital Logic DesignA8432
Data StructuresO10440
Discrete MathematicsA+9327
Computer Programming LabO10220
Technical CommunicationA8216
Total19171
SGPA Calculation: Total Quality Points = 171 Total Credits = 19 SGPA = 171 ÷ 19 = 9.00 Arjun's 3rd Semester SGPA: 9.00 (Excellent — top tier)

📚 Example 2: Mixed Performance Semester

Priya's 5th semester with varied performance:

CourseGradeGrade PointsCreditsQuality Points
Operating SystemsA+9436
Database ManagementA8324
Computer NetworksB+7428
Theory of ComputationB6318
OS LabA+9218
DBMS LabO10220
Soft SkillsA8216
Total20160
SGPA Calculation: Total Quality Points = 160 Total Credits = 20 SGPA = 160 ÷ 20 = 8.00 Priya's 5th Semester SGPA: 8.00 (Very Good) Note: Despite getting B (6) in one core course, strong performance in labs and other courses produced solid 8.00 SGPA. This is why weighted averages reward broad consistency.

📚 Example 3: US 4.0 Scale Student

Maria's spring semester at a US university:

CourseGradeGrade PointsCreditsQuality Points
Calculus IIA−3.7414.8
General ChemistryA4.0416.0
English CompositionA4.0312.0
Introductory ProgrammingB+3.339.9
History 101A−3.7311.1
PE / ElectiveA4.014.0
Total1867.8
Semester GPA Calculation (US 4.0 Scale): Total Quality Points = 67.8 Total Credits = 18 Semester GPA = 67.8 ÷ 18 = 3.77 Maria's Spring Semester GPA: 3.77 (Strong) Letter equivalent: A− (Magna Cum Laude eligible) Dean's List eligible at most universities

📑 University Grade Systems

Different universities use slightly different grade-to-points mappings. Knowing yours is essential:

🇮🇳 India CBCS Standard (Most Universities)

LetterGrade PointsPercentageDescription
O1090+Outstanding
A+980-89Excellent
A870-79Very Good
B+760-69Good
B650-59Above Average
C545-49Average
P440-44Pass
F0<40Fail

🏛️ VTU Karnataka (Unique Letters)

LetterGrade PointsPercentage
O1090+
A+980-89
A870-79
B+760-69
B655-59
C550-54
P440-49
F0<40

🇺🇸 US 4.0 Scale

LetterGrade PointsPercentage
A+, A4.093-100
A−3.790-92
B+3.387-89
B3.083-86
B−2.780-82
C+2.377-79
C2.073-76
D1.060-69
F0<60
⚠️ Important: Specific grade-to-percentage mappings vary by institution. Some universities use stricter cutoffs (A = 85+ vs 80+); some are more lenient. Always verify with your university's official grading policy or grade sheet legend for accurate conversion.

📊 SGPA to Percentage Conversion

Converting your SGPA to a percentage equivalent requires using your university's specific formula. Different institutions use different multipliers:

📐 Standard CBSE / Delhi University / AKTU / MAKAUT
Percentage = SGPA × 9.5 — most widely used formula. Based on CBSE's official conversion methodology where 95% midpoint maps to 10 SGPA.
🏛️ BITS Pilani / IITs / VIT / Manipal
Percentage = SGPA × 10 — direct multiplication. Used at premier institutions, makes SGPA → percentage straightforward.
⚙️ VTU / Anna University / JNTUH / JNTUK
Percentage = (SGPA − 0.75) × 10 — adjusted formula accounting for grade compression. Used by major engineering universities.
🏗️ JNTUA / GTU / KTU
Percentage = (SGPA − 0.5) × 10 — slightly different adjustment. Common in specific engineering universities.
🏛️ Mumbai University
Percentage = (7.1 × SGPA) + 11 — unique linear formula. Different mathematical relationship than standard.
🌟 Bangalore University
Percentage = (SGPA − 0.75) × 10 — same as VTU formula.

📋 Quick Reference Conversion Table

SGPA× 9.5 (CBSE)× 10 (BITS)(SGPA−0.75)×10 (VTU)Mumbai
10.095.0%100%92.5%82.0%
9.590.25%95%87.5%78.45%
9.085.5%90%82.5%74.9%
8.580.75%85%77.5%71.35%
8.076.0%80%72.5%67.8%
7.571.25%75%67.5%64.25%
7.066.5%70%62.5%60.7%
6.561.75%65%57.5%57.15%
6.057.0%60%52.5%53.6%

⚠️ Common SGPA Calculation Mistakes

  • 1. Simple averaging instead of credit-weighted: Just averaging grade points without multiplying by credits gives wrong result. Always weight by credits.
  • 2. Wrong grade-to-point mapping: Using US 4.0 conversions for Indian 10-point system (or vice versa). Verify your scale.
  • 3. Excluding pass/fail courses correctly: P/NP graded courses shouldn't be in SGPA calculation; F should be (with 0 grade points).
  • 4. Forgetting credit hours for labs: Lab courses typically have lower credits (1-2 vs 3-4 for theory). Don't equate them.
  • 5. Missing one course: Forgetting to include a course can significantly skew SGPA. Verify all courses appear.
  • 6. Wrong credit hours: Using textbook credits vs official assigned credits. Always use official.
  • 7. Rounding errors: Rounding intermediate calculations leads to final answer drift. Round only final result.
  • 8. Confusing SGPA with CGPA: SGPA is one semester; CGPA is cumulative. Don't mix.
  • 9. Not verifying against official: Always cross-check your calculation with official grade sheet.
  • 10. Using wrong university formula for %: CBSE × 9.5 ≠ VTU (CGPA − 0.75) × 10. Verify your institution's formula.

Failed courses (F grade) count in SGPA with 0 grade points but their credits still count toward total. This means F's drag SGPA down significantly, especially in high-credit courses. F in a 4-credit course contributes 0 quality points but 4 credits to total — pulling average lower. Retaking failed courses (where permitted) is the main recovery option.
